    Ford began using hardened valve seats in the early 1970s, primarily to accommodate unleaded gasoline. This change was crucial for improving engine durability and performance. The transition allowed Ford engines to withstand higher temperatures and reduce wear over time.

    Hardened Valve Seats in Ford Engines Explained

    Hardened valve seats are vital components in internal combustion engines. They provide a durable surface for the valves to seal against, preventing leaks and ensuring efficient combustion. The introduction of these seats was a response to the increasing use of unleaded gasoline, which could cause traditional seats to wear out more quickly.

    The shift to hardened valve seats also aligned with regulatory changes aimed at reducing emissions. This modification not only improved engine longevity but also enhanced overall performance.

    Hardened Valve Seat Installation Techniques

    Understanding the installation techniques for hardened valve seats is crucial for ensuring optimal engine performance and longevity. This section delves into the specific methods and best practices used in the installation process, providing valuable insights for both amateur mechanics and seasoned professionals looking to enhance their engine rebuilds. Proper installation can significantly impact the durability and efficiency of the engine.

    Installing hardened valve seats requires precision and expertise. Here are key steps for successful installation:

    1. Remove Cylinder Head: Detach the cylinder head from the engine block.

    2. Inspect Valve Seats: Check for wear and damage before proceeding.

    3. Machine for New Seats: Use a seat cutting tool to prepare the area for new seats.

    4. Install Hardened Seats: Press the new seats into place carefully.

    5. Reassemble Engine: Reattach the cylinder head and ensure all components are secure.
